武夷山土壤动物群落结构在凋落物分解过程中的变化

摘    要:采用凋落叶分解样袋法,对北亚热带常绿阔叶林米槠凋落叶分解过程中土壤动物群落结构动态进行研究。结果表明:土壤动物类群数在分解前期较多,中、小型土壤动物个体数量在分解中期剧增,土壤动物群落多样性指数与类群数呈显著的正相关关系(r=0.74,P〈0.05)。蜱螨目和弹尾目为凋落物分解过程中出现的优势类群,两者个体数量之和占总数的82.4%。优势类群蜱螨目及其中隐气亚目、中气亚目和弹尾目均与凋落物损失量呈显著正相关;常见类群中,等足目和双翅目数量与凋落物损失量正相关性不显著,其他常见类群膜翅目、蜘蛛目、同翅目、鞘翅目和鳞翅目数量与凋落物损失量呈负相关关系。

Dynamic Change of Soil Fauna Community Structure in the Course of Litter Decomposition on the Wuyi Mountains

Abstract:The decomposition course of Castanopsis cuspidata leaf litter in the northern subtropical evergreen broad-leaved forests,and the dynamics and diversity of soil fauna community of the Wuyi Mountains were studied by litter bag method.The results showed that the number of soil animal groups was relatively larger in the early stage of decomposition,and the number of medium and small sized soil animals in the fauna increased rapidly in the mid-stage.The diversity index of soil fauna was significantly and positiv...
